For residents, the Gambling Act 2003 targets providers, not individual players. You can enjoy real-money pokies and live dealer tables on overseas sites without breaking local rules. Since New Zealand does not issue online casino licences, a legal online casino New Zealand is simply an offshore casino with a reputable licence that accepts Kiwi customers.
How online gambling regulations work in New Zealand
The legal framework is straightforward. Overseas operators cannot offer unlicensed gambling services to people in New Zealand, but the government does not licence online casinos. As a result, international sites based in Malta, the UK, Curacao, or Alderney fill the gap.
These sites must follow the rules of their licensing authority, including security checks and fairness testing. Some are built specifically for Kiwis and accept NZD. What makes a New Zealand online casino legal and safe
A trustworthy legal online casino New Zealand displays a valid licence number in the footer. If the regulator cannot verify the domain, move on. Malta, Gibraltar, the UK, and Curacao are common licensing jurisdictions.
Safety also means SSL encryption, two-factor authentication, and clear privacy policies. Compliant sites separate player funds from business accounts and offer responsible gambling tools. This makes your money safer and gives you someone to contact if an issue appears.

Wagering requirements explained
The wagering requirement is how many times you must bet the bonus before withdrawing. A $100 bonus with 35x playthrough means $3,500 in total bets. Pokies usually count fully, while table games count less. Choose a bonus with a reasonable wagering target and no hidden maximum win cap.
